免费注册 查看新帖 |

Chinaunix

广告
  平台 论坛 博客 文库
123下一页
最近访问板块 发新帖
查看: 19504 | 回复: 28
打印 上一主题 下一主题

linux下如何mount整个硬盘 [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2010-12-22 15:57 |只看该作者 |倒序浏览
linxu下加入了一块硬盘
Disk /dev/sdc: 146.8 GB, 146815733760 bytes
255 heads, 63 sectors/track, 17849 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es

   Device Boot      Start         End      Blocks   Id  System
/dev/sdc1               1       17849   143372061   83  Linux


mount /dec/sdc1 /fileroot可以

mount /dec/sdc /fileroot就不行提示mount: you must specify the filesystem type
我不想mount分区,想mount整个硬盘应该如何处理啊

论坛徽章:
0
2 [报告]
发表于 2010-12-22 16:09 |只看该作者
你这盘 分过区吧    把分区删除了 可以挂整个盘

论坛徽章:
0
3 [报告]
发表于 2010-12-22 16:35 |只看该作者
我把分区删了还是不行
# fdisk -l
Disk /dev/sdc: 146.8 GB, 146815733760 bytes
255 heads, 63 sectors/track, 17849 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es

Device Boot      Start         End      Blocks   Id  System

#mount /dev/sdc /fileroot2
mount: you must specify the filesystem type

论坛徽章:
0
4 [报告]
发表于 2010-12-22 16:45 |只看该作者
本帖最后由 taojie2000 于 2010-12-22 16:48 编辑

回复 3# aaa_asp


    我看了下  那边机器挂新盘也带个1  把整个硬盘分一个大区  记错了.

    mount 挂的是个文件系统  sdc表示是个盘

论坛徽章:
34
亥猪
日期:2015-03-20 13:55:11戌狗
日期:2015-03-20 13:57:01酉鸡
日期:2015-03-20 14:03:56未羊
日期:2015-03-20 14:18:30子鼠
日期:2015-03-20 14:20:14丑牛
日期:2015-03-20 14:20:31辰龙
日期:2015-03-20 14:35:34巳蛇
日期:2015-03-20 14:35:56操作系统版块每日发帖之星
日期:2015-11-06 06:20:00操作系统版块每日发帖之星
日期:2015-11-08 06:20:00操作系统版块每日发帖之星
日期:2015-11-19 06:20:00黄金圣斗士
日期:2015-11-24 10:43:13
5 [报告]
发表于 2010-12-22 16:59 |只看该作者
你要挂载的是分区 sdc1,而不是硬盘 sdc !
在 windows 下面也需要先把硬盘进行划分,才能给盘符 c d e 啊~

论坛徽章:
0
6 [报告]
发表于 2010-12-22 17:09 |只看该作者
我要挂的是整个硬盘

这里另外一台机器外加过一个硬盘sdb
Disk /dev/sdb: 146.8 GB, 146815733760 bytes
255 heads, 63 sectors/track, 17849 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es

Disk /dev/sdb doesn't contain a valid partition table
在/etc/fstab
/dev/sdb               /fileroot/fileserver     ext3    defaults        0 0
这样就可以用,配置这台机器的人走了

我参照这样配置就不行,还需要配置其它地方吗

论坛徽章:
0
7 [报告]
发表于 2010-12-22 17:53 |只看该作者
哪位高手帮忙看看

论坛徽章:
0
8 [报告]
发表于 2010-12-22 18:35 |只看该作者
本帖最后由 mahao_boy 于 2010-12-22 18:37 编辑

每个新硬盘都没有自带分区表
所以我们需要给硬盘分区,目的就是给硬盘建立分区表

新添盘后
#:fdisk -l
.....
Disk /dev/sdb doesn't contain a valid partition table
....

所以需要:
#:fdisk /dev/sdb
Command (m for help): w
The partition table has been altered!

Calling ioctl() to re-read partition table.
Syncing disks.

直接输入w就是整个硬盘直接写入分区表,当作一个分区
#:mkfs.ext3 /dev/sdb

然后就可以
mount /dev/sdb /some/

我是在本地虚拟机上做的操作
环境:
LSB Version:    :core-3.1-ia32:core-3.1-noarch:graphics-3.1-ia32:graphics-3.1-noarch
Distributor ID: CentOS
Description:    CentOS release 5.5 (Final)
Release:        5.5
Codename:       Final

不知道以上的结论对不对

招聘 : 技术支持/维
论坛徽章:
0
9 [报告]
发表于 2010-12-22 18:37 |只看该作者
最好不要直接在一个磁盘上做文件系统,建议先创建一个分区。

论坛徽章:
0
10 [报告]
发表于 2010-12-22 18:45 |只看该作者
回复 8# mahao_boy


    你这硬盘是全新 第一次用?
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P